Arsenal land Edu
Arsenal have completed the signing of Brazilian midfielder Edu.
The 22-year-old's move to Highbury from Sao Paulo outfit Corinthians has gone through after the player secured a Portuguese passport.
The Gunners have refused to confirm what fee they have paid for the player, although it is believed to be in the region of £5million.
Arsenal boss Arsene Wenger thought he had tied up the deal to secure a man he sees as the natural replacement for Emmanuel Petit during the summer, only for Edu to be refused admission to the country when it was found his passport was false.
It completes a good day for Wenger, who secured the services of Dennis Bergkamp for a further two years after the Dutch striker elected to commit his short-term future with the London giants.
"We are naturally pleased to have eventually signed him," said Wenger.
"He is a very talented player with great potential."
